Rumah >hujung hadapan web >tutorial css >Bagaimanakah Saya Boleh Menyesuaikan Senarai Tertib dalam Firefox 3 (dan Lebih dari itu)?

Bagaimanakah Saya Boleh Menyesuaikan Senarai Tertib dalam Firefox 3 (dan Lebih dari itu)?

Linda Hamilton
Linda Hamiltonasal
2024-12-09 02:20:08545semak imbas

How Can I Customize Ordered Lists in Firefox 3 (and Beyond)?

Menyesuaikan Senarai Tertib dalam Firefox 3

Nombor Senarai Menjajarkan Kiri

Untuk menjajarkan kiri nombor dalam senarai tersusun, anda boleh menggunakan CSS untuk mengatasi penggayaan lalai:

ol {
  counter-reset: item;
  margin-left: 0;
  padding-left: 0;
}

li {
  display: block;
  margin-bottom: .5em;
  margin-left: 2em;
}

li::before {
  display: inline-block;
  content: counter(item) ") ";
  counter-increment: item;
  width: 2em;
  margin-left: -2em;
}

Menukar Aksara Selepas Senarai Nombor

Untuk menukar aksara selepas nombor senarai, ubah suai sifat kandungan dalam peraturan li::before:

li::before {
  ...
  content: counter(item) "a) ";
  ...
}

Menukar kepada Senarai Abjad/Romawi

Untuk tukar daripada nombor kepada senarai abjad atau roman menggunakan CSS, gunakan gabungan set semula balas, fungsi pembilang() dan kandungan property:

ol {
  list-style-type: none;
  counter-reset: my-counter;
}

li {
  display: block;
  counter-increment: my-counter;
}

li::before {
  content: counters(my-counter, lower-alpha) ". ";
  ...
}

Untuk angka Rom:

li::before {
  content: counters(my-counter, lower-roman) ". ";
  ...
}

Perhatikan bahawa teknik ini mungkin tidak berfungsi dalam pelayar lama, termasuk Internet Explorer 7.

Atas ialah kandungan terperinci Bagaimanakah Saya Boleh Menyesuaikan Senarai Tertib dalam Firefox 3 (dan Lebih dari itu)?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n